

{"id":615,"date":"2022-08-19T12:32:11","date_gmt":"2022-08-19T12:32:11","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.ojaseyehospital.com\/blog\/?p=615"},"modified":"2022-08-19T12:33:28","modified_gmt":"2022-08-19T12:33:28","slug":"heterochromia","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.ojaseyehospital.com\/blog\/heterochromia\/","title":{"rendered":"Heterochromia"},"content":{"rendered":"\n<h2>What  is heterochromia?<\/h2>\n <p> It is a condition in which the  affected person has more than one eye color. It does not affect your body. It&#8217;s  just a character of your genes passed down from your parents. In certain cases,  heterochromia is a symptom of a medical condition. Heterochromia is a common  condition among animals such as cats and dogs but rare in humans.<\/p>\n<h2>Symptoms of heterochromia<\/h2>\n<p>The different eye color of the iris is  a symptom of heterochromia. The iris gets its color from a pigment known as  melanin. Less melanin cause light color of eyes, whereas more melanin makes the  eyes darker.<\/p>\n<h2>Causes<\/h2>\n<p>It is a harmless genetic mutation  that affects the pigments of human irises. Sudden loss of vision is  also common.<\/p>\n<h2>Types of heterochromia<\/h2>\n<p>Heterochromia is of three types: <\/p>\n<ul>\n  <li><strong>Complete  heterochromia<\/strong>: In this condition, only one iris has a different  color from the other. For example, if you have one grey eye and one brown eye.  It is also known as heterochromia iridis.<\/li>\n  <li><strong>Segmental  heterochromia<\/strong>: the condition in which different parts of one iris  have a different color. The condition is also known as heterochromia iridium.<\/li>\n  <li><strong>Central  heterochromia<\/strong>: It is a condition in which the outer ring of your  iris has a different color.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Diagnosis of heterochromia<\/h2>\n<p>If there is any change in color in  your infant&#8217;s eye, your doctor will examine your child&#8217;s eye. The doctor may  seek information about you how long your child has had heterochromia. He will  ask whether your child has any other symptoms. The doctor might order genetics  or blood tests on your child.<\/p>\n<h2>Heterochromia treatment <\/h2>\n<p>The treatment of heterochromia only  focuses on treating the underlying causes of diseases. If the eyes do not get  affected, no treatment is needed for heterochromia.<\/p>\n\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>It is a condition in which the affected person has more than one eye color.
